Greensboro’s humidity and strong summer sun can wear down painted surfaces faster than many homeowners expect. Touch-ups help preserve trim, siding, doors, and interior walls by catching early signs of deterioration before they worsen. Homes in Whitsett, Pleasant Garden, Gibsonville, Stokesdale, and Colfax can benefit from routine maintenance that helps limit moisture intrusion and reduce the risk of wood rot. From a small crack in the fascia to a hallway scuff, timely touch-ups help maintain both appearance and long-term surface protection. Our painters prepare each area correctly and match colors with precision so the finish looks intentional, not patched. Drywall Repair

Drywall repair addresses dents, holes, and settling cracks before new paint goes on. In Julian and Climax, small wall imperfections are common from daily use and seasonal movement. Repairing them first helps touch-ups bond properly and finish evenly. Our process includes taping, mudding, sanding, and priming to create a clean surface for paint.

Paint Touch-Ups for Every Season in Greensboro

Greensboro’s changing weather creates different needs throughout the year. Each season affects painted surfaces in its own way, which is why timing touch-ups can make a difference in how long repairs last.

Greensboro, NC, Spring Paint Touch-Ups

Spring is a smart time to address the damage left behind by winter on exterior surfaces. As temperatures rise in Mc Leansville and Browns Summit, painters can repair peeling trim, worn caulk, and faded front doors. These touch-ups help restore curb appeal and prepare your home for the humid months ahead.

Greensboro, NC, Fall Paint Touch-Ups

Fall brings cooler temperatures and lower humidity, making it one of the most effective seasons for exterior touch-ups in the Greensboro area. This is a good time to address sun-faded areas on south-facing walls and close gaps before winter moisture arrives. Homes in Oak Ridge and Stokesdale can benefit from this seasonal maintenance to help protect painted surfaces through colder weather.

Greensboro House Painting FAQs

Painting homes in Greensboro takes more than a brush and ladder. Learn what affects timing, pricing, approvals, and long-term results in North Carolina’s climate.

  • Most exterior paint projects take about 5 to 7 working days. In Greensboro, though, humidity often slows drying between coats, and spring rain can interrupt the schedule while surfaces are being prepped or painted.

  • Several details shape the final cost, including the home’s size, the condition of the surfaces, and the quality of paint selected. Many older homes in Irving Park need extra repair work for peeling paint or wood rot, while homes in Lake Jeanette may have more square footage to cover. Using higher-grade, UV-resistant paint for strong sun exposure can also raise the total.

  • In many Greensboro communities, especially newer neighborhoods near Friendly Acres or Adams Farm, an HOA design review may be required. Homeowners are often asked to submit exterior color choices for approval before work starts so the project follows neighborhood rules and supports property values.

  • Make sure the painter has valid general liability coverage and workers' compensation insurance in North Carolina. It also helps to ask for references from recent projects nearby, whether the home is a historic property in Sunset Hills or a newer house in Summerfield. A clear written contract is also important.

  • Late spring and early fall usually provide the most reliable conditions. Temperatures are milder and humidity is often lower, which helps paint cure correctly. It is also smart to avoid extreme summer heat and heavy pollen periods that can affect the finish.

  • Peeling and blistering often show up on sun-facing walls, especially on south sides like those found in Starmount. Mildew is more common on shaded areas that stay damp, including homes near Lake Brandt. On older wood siding in College Hill, cracking can develop after years of seasonal movement.

  • A professional paint job is often one of the better return-on-investment improvements a homeowner can make. In a competitive Greensboro market, fresh paint can strengthen curb appeal, help the property stand out, and support a quicker sale at a better price.

  • Yes. Today’s low-VOC and zero-VOC paints are strong choices, especially for interior spaces where odor matters. For exterior use, many premium eco-friendly products now offer the durability, moisture resistance, and mold protection needed for Greensboro’s humidity and seasonal rain.

  • For exterior siding, satin and low-lustre finishes are common because they help conceal small flaws and are easy to keep clean. Semi-gloss is a solid choice for trim and doors since it stands up well to weather and regular wear. In humid conditions, the right primer is essential for proper bonding.

  • Rinse the exterior once a year with a garden hose to remove pollen and dirt. Keep shrubs and tree limbs trimmed so moisture does not stay against the siding. Check caulk around windows and doors often and repair any gaps quickly to stop water from getting behind the paint.
